Water hammer problems, pipe noise due to water hitting the back of the pipe, can be easily repaired. Anchor any easily-accessible loose pipes. If the pipes are in the walls, floors or ceiling, you may want to call a professional to come and help complete the project.

If you have a frozen pipe, turn on the nearest faucet so the water has an escape route when the pipe starts to thaw. This can relieve the pipe pressure that could cause bursting and further home damage.

Make sure the job gets done by not paying your plumber until you are satisfied, and the work is completed. You may be required to put some money down before a job is started, but never pay the total cost until you know the job has been completed correctly. Put the strainer on top of drains to catch any food that would go down and cause a clog. Your kitchen sink strainer needs cleaning every time something big gets stuck in it. Clean out the bathtup strainer every few days before it becomes clogged.

Be sure that the overflow holes are free of debris. Overflow holes drain water if a sink begins to overfill, so they need to be clear at all times. When you do periodic checks for any other problems or repairs that are needed, take the time to clear the holes that are there to protect you from overflow.
Ensure that if something goes wrong in your garbage disposal that you resist any and all urges you have that might make you want to put your hands inside to fix a problem. A garbage disposal can be dangerous, even when it is not on. Troubleshooting techniques and schematics of your garbage disposal are available on the Internet.
Use cold water when using your garbage disposal. The cold water helps the blades that are inside stay sharp, and will keep your disposal running smoothly. Grease will stay solid and go through your drain with cold water; you don’t want gooey grease in your pipes.
